// Scale down aWindowRenderSource into a RenderSource of size
// mBufferSize * (1 << aLevel) and return that RenderSource.
// Don't scale down by more than a factor of 2 with a single scaling operation,
// because it'll look bad. If higher scales are needed, use another
// intermediate target by calling this function recursively with aLevel + 1.
RefPtr<RenderSource> ScreenshotGrabberImpl::ScaleDownWindowRenderSourceToSize(
    Window& aWindow, const IntSize& aDestSize,
    RenderSource* aWindowRenderSource, size_t aLevel) {
  if (aLevel == mCachedLevels.Length()) {
    mCachedLevels.AppendElement(
        aWindow.CreateDownscaleTarget(mBufferSize * (1 << aLevel)));
  }
  MOZ_RELEASE_ASSERT(aLevel < mCachedLevels.Length());

  RefPtr<RenderSource> renderSource = aWindowRenderSource;
  IntSize sourceSize = aWindowRenderSource->Size();
  if (sourceSize.width > aDestSize.width * 2) {
    sourceSize = aDestSize * 2;
    renderSource = ScaleDownWindowRenderSourceToSize(
        aWindow, sourceSize, aWindowRenderSource, aLevel + 1);
  }

  if (renderSource) {
    if (mCachedLevels[aLevel]->DownscaleFrom(
            renderSource, IntRect({}, sourceSize), IntRect({}, aDestSize))) {
      return mCachedLevels[aLevel]->AsRenderSource();
    }
  }
  return nullptr;
}

void ScreenshotGrabberImpl::GrabScreenshot(Window& aWindow,
                                           const IntSize& aWindowSize) {
  RefPtr<RenderSource> windowRenderSource =
      aWindow.GetWindowContents(aWindowSize);

  if (!windowRenderSource) {
    PROFILER_MARKER_UNTYPED(
        "NoCompositorScreenshot because of unsupported compositor "
        "configuration",
        GRAPHICS);
    return;
  }

  if (aWindowSize.IsEmpty() || mBufferSize.IsEmpty()) {
    return;
  }

  Size windowSize(aWindowSize);
  float scale = std::min(mBufferSize.width / windowSize.width,
                         mBufferSize.height / windowSize.height);
  IntSize scaledSize = Max(IntSize::Round(windowSize * scale), IntSize(1, 1));
  RefPtr<RenderSource> scaledTarget = ScaleDownWindowRenderSourceToSize(
      aWindow, scaledSize, windowRenderSource, 0);

  if (!scaledTarget) {
    PROFILER_MARKER_UNTYPED(
        "NoCompositorScreenshot because ScaleDownWindowRenderSourceToSize "
        "failed",
        GRAPHICS);
    return;
  }

  RefPtr<AsyncReadbackBuffer> buffer = TakeNextBuffer(aWindow);
  if (!buffer) {
    PROFILER_MARKER_UNTYPED(
        "NoCompositorScreenshot because AsyncReadbackBuffer creation failed",
        GRAPHICS);
    return;
  }

  buffer->CopyFrom(scaledTarget);

  // This QueueItem will be added to the queue at the end of the next call to
  // ProcessQueue(). This ensures that the buffer isn't mapped into main memory
  // until the next frame. If we did it in this frame, we'd block on the GPU.
  mCurrentFrameQueueItem =
      Some(QueueItem{TimeStamp::Now(), std::move(buffer), scaledSize,
                     windowRenderSource->Size()});
}

void ScreenshotGrabberImpl::ProcessQueue() {
  if (!mQueue.IsEmpty()) {
    if (!mProfilerScreenshots) {
      mProfilerScreenshots = new ProfilerScreenshots();
    }
    for (const auto& item : mQueue) {
      mProfilerScreenshots->SubmitScreenshot(
          item.mWindowSize, item.mScreenshotSize, item.mTimeStamp,
          [&item](DataSourceSurface* aTargetSurface) {
            return item.mScreenshotBuffer->MapAndCopyInto(aTargetSurface,
                                                          item.mScreenshotSize);
          });
      ReturnBuffer(item.mScreenshotBuffer);
    }
  }
  mQueue.Clear();

  if (mCurrentFrameQueueItem) {
    mQueue.AppendElement(std::move(*mCurrentFrameQueueItem));
    mCurrentFrameQueueItem = Nothing();
  }
}
